The Best UK Bunk Beds

Bunk beds can be a great way to save space in your kids' bedroom. Bunk beds are a great solution to make space in the bedroom of a child. They can also be a fun and unique way to decorate the room.

3ft-single-metal-bunk-bed-frame-2-storey-2-sleepers-bed-frame-bunk-bed-can-be-used-as-two-single-beds-bedroom-dorm-apartment-for-adults-children-teenagers-twins-white-162.jpgAll bunk beds sold in Britain must comply with strict safety standards. This includes requirements to prevent children from getting stuck between bunk bed.

Space-saving

A bunk bed can to save space in a small space. They also can help create a sense of security in shared spaces, and give children the opportunity to have their own space.

They also make good vertical use, which can create the illusion of greater space and increase area for flooring. Loft beds and bunk beds come in various designs. From simple designs that have one bed perpendicular to the other, to more sophisticated designs that include a desk or storage and storage, you can find them all.

There are bunk beds that are space-saving constructed from a variety of materials, including solid wooden. Some are made of veneers and manufactured wood, or particleboard, however the majority are built to last for many years.

There are bunk beds with many extra features that kids will enjoy. They include drawers and nooks in the bottom bunk which are a great spot to store small things like books, toys or school supplies.

For teenagers, you can find space saving bunk beds with shelving or a desk built into the top of the bed. These are great for a study or home office and offer plenty of space for other furniture and other accessories.

If you are on an affordable budget, there are great space-saving buy bunk beds beds for less than PS500. They are usually less expensive than other types of bunk beds uk beds, but they're still an excellent long-term investment.

A bunk bed is an excellent choice for short-term lodging. For example, you can find bunk beds in student residences, sports centres, MoD accommodations, emergency first responder units, and hostels.

Bunk beds are also a good option for sleepovers as they can accommodate up to three beds in one. This will make your room less cluttered and allow you to sleep more comfortably.

Safety

If you're buying bunk beds for your children, it's important to ensure they're safe. They should adhere to safety guidelines, and you must teach them how to be used safely.

In the UK all bunk beds must meet strict standards to prevent children from becoming trapped in the bed's structure. These include British Standard EN747-1:2012+A1:2015, which requires that bunk beds are solid and have no sharp edges. These standards also state that all guard rails must be high enough for children to not fall out of bed.

You should also think about installing a bed ladder for your bunk. make sure that it is solid, sturdy and safe. A ladder that is not sturdy can be dangerous and could cause serious injuries, so it's important that your children are able to climb up to the top bunk safely without falling off.

It is crucial to teach your child about bunk bed safety. Make sure they know how to use the stairs correctly so that they don't injure themselves or the person on the bed below. You must also ensure that your child understands that the bunk bed should not be used as a playground space, and that they should not climb over it.

Bunk beds should also be equipped with guard rails that are attached to the bottom of the bed. They should be at least 16cm high from the base of the mattress to the top of the mattress, to stop your child from rolling off.

These rules are based on the belief that gaps or gaps in bunk beds usa bed structures could allow a child to get trapped or stuck between the rail and the mattress which can result in injuries from entrapment. These injuries can be extremely painful and may even result in death.

Like all furniture in your home, it is important to regularly check your bunk beds for signs of wear or damage. Contact the manufacturer if you observe any issues.

If you are making the bunk bed yourself, make sure you inspect each piece before building it. You can avoid any potential hazards such as screws that aren't present and other hardware.
